Biography
Dr. Rocha-Miranda is Director of the Brazilian Academy of Sciences. He received his Doctor in Medicine in 1961 at the “Universidade do Brasil”, where he served as Professor and Head of the Neurobiology II Lab at the Biophysics Institute and Senior Researcher of the National Research Council. He had postdoctoral experience at NIMH, Bethesda, Maryland and Harvard University. After his retirement in 1991, he became a member of the board of the Brazilian Academy of Sciences. His honors include Full Cross of the Order of Scientific Merit (1994), TWAS Prize in Biology (1995), Emeritus Researcher of the National Research Council (2005) and the medal of the Brazilian Society of Neuroscience. He was elected Associate Member of the Brazilian Academy of Sciences in 1972 and Full Member in 1978.
